Read full chapter. Acts 11 is the beginning of the transition of attention from the disciples, particularly Peter, to Paul. In Acts 12, James the brother of John is killed: the first of the twelve disciples to be martyred and the only one to have his death recorded in Scripture ( Acts 12:1–2 ). The book of Acts is a continuation of the Gospel of Luke, following Jesus’ followers as they are given the power of God's Spirit and tasked with spreading the good news of God's Kingdom to the ancient world. This is the beginning of the international, multiethnic Church. What is the book of Acts about in the Bible?Acts 3:21. Context Summary. Acts 7:54–60 finishes the story of the Jesus-follower Stephen. He has been falsely accused of blasphemy against God, Moses, the Mosaic law, and the temple ( Acts 6:8–15 ). He has used the history of the Jews to show how over the years the Jews have come to worship Moses, the Law, and the temple like idols ( Acts 7:1–53 ).Act 13:6.
